Struggling Pet Owners Grapple with Skyrocketing Vet Bills

With veterinary costs on the rise, pet owners across Germany are finding it increasingly hard to afford treatment for their furry friends. Emergency aid organizations like the Soziale Tier-Not-Hilfe Frankfurt are reporting a surge in requests for assistance. Their chairwoman, Simone Glaser, shares that since the pandemic, they've received more applications from people who purchased pets and later couldn't shoulder their healthcare expenses.

Sadly, the Frankfurt organization can't help in these situations. They offer aid solely to Frankfurt residents who prove financial hardship, such as homelessness or a meager pension. Glaser laments the fact that their resources are stretched thin due to the uptick in requests and the ballooning vet expenses.

Echoing similar concerns, the "Wau-Mau-Insel" animal shelter in Kassel acknowledges receiving appeals from neighboring regions as well. However, they too must deny assistance due to their limited resources. This has prompted the shelter's manager, Karsten Plücker, to urge potential pet parents to factor in the potential costs before making the commitment.

Sigrid Faust-Schmidt, from the State Animal Welfare Association, has observed a growing trend of pet owners nationwide seeking aid with their medical expenses. These financial pressures have driven some owners to delay seeking vet care, resulting in more medically undernourished animals arriving at shelters.
